Nature and trails

From Harderwijk, you can go walking and cycling in the natural surroundings of the Veluwe. In Hierden, the original character has been preserved thanks to the wealth of northern Veluwe farmsteads. The landscape also includes the Hierdense Beek, a natural stream that flows north into the Veluwemeer. In spring, the ditches along the Veluwemeer coast turn golden yellow with blooming marsh marigolds.

One specific route is the Veluwemeerkust-Hulshorst walk: it is just under 9 kilometres long and leads through the surroundings of Hierden. For mountain biking, the Harderwijk MTB Route is available, also known as the “Groene Lus”. The route is 21 kilometres long, includes 165 metres of elevation gain and features technical single tracks. The Groene Lus also offers views across the Beekhuizerzand.

The Harderwijker Toren- & Streekroute starts at the Vischpoort in Harderwijk’s historic city centre. On the section near the Toekantoren, 226 steps must be climbed to a height of 42 metres. The route passes through the approximately 200-hectare dune and drift-sand area of Beekhuizerzand.

Water and harbour

In Harderwijk, you can enjoy recreation on and around Wolderwijd. A SUP rental service starts at Strandeiland on Harderwijk’s promenade and allows you to explore Wolderwijd. Harderwijk’s city beach offers relaxation by the water, as well as a playground and trampolines for children.

The Bottermuseum & the Botterloods Harderwijk also highlight the connection with the former world of the water. They present the city’s sailing and fishing heritage; trips on authentic botters are also offered.

History and cityscape

In the Middle Ages, Harderwijk was an important trading centre on the Zuiderzee. The historic centre contains more than 100 listed buildings with beautiful façades. One of the most distinctive remnants is the Vischpoort, the only surviving town gate on the water in Harderwijk. It was built at the end of the 14th century, while its upper section dates from the 15th century. The De Hoop windmill is a historic monument in Harderwijk’s Historic Harbour District.

The “Stadswandeling open monumenten” is a walking tour through Harderwijk that starts at the Old Town Hall. It leads through the Vleeshouwersteeg and Grolsteeg and to historic buildings around the Vischmarkt, including the Agnietenklooster and the Burgemeestershuis. The archaeological cellar of the Dwangburcht is accessible year-round only as part of a city walking tour and can be visited during this tour.

Restored vault paintings can once again be viewed in the Grote Kerk. The audio tour of the Grote Kerk explains the unique vault paintings and is available in Dutch, English and German.

Museums and special places

The Marius van Dokkum Museum is located in the former Snijkamer of the University of Harderwijk and is dedicated to the work of a living artist. It displays humorous paintings, including works in which pears are recurring motifs.

The Dolfinarium offers eight educational animal presentations in which the keepers explain the marine animals. The park also has four playgrounds with slides, a zip line and themed play equipment. From Harderwijk railway station, the Dolfinarium can be reached by various buses to the Boulevard (Dolfinarium) stop; from there, it is less than a ten-minute walk to the park.
